std::basic_string_view<CharT,Traits>::find

Finds the first substring equal to the given character sequence.

# Declarations

constexpr size_type find( basic_string_view v, size_type pos = 0 ) const noexcept;

(since C++17)

constexpr size_type find( CharT ch, size_type pos = 0 ) const noexcept;

(since C++17)

constexpr size_type find( const CharT* s, size_type pos, size_type count ) const;

(since C++17)

constexpr size_type find( const CharT* s, size_type pos = 0 ) const;

(since C++17)

# Parameters

# Return value

Position of the first character of the found substring, or npos if no such substring is found.

# Example

#include <string_view>
 
int main()
{
    using namespace std::literals;
 
    constexpr auto str{" long long int;"sv};
 
    static_assert(
        1 == str.find("long"sv)            && "<- find(v , pos = 0)" &&
        6 == str.find("long"sv, 2)         && "<- find(v , pos = 2)" &&
        0 == str.find(' ')                 && "<- find(ch, pos = 0)" &&
        2 == str.find('o', 1)              && "<- find(ch, pos = 1)" &&
        2 == str.find("on")                && "<- find(s , pos = 0)" &&
        6 == str.find("long double", 5, 4) && "<- find(s , pos = 5, count = 4)"
    );
 
    static_assert(str.npos == str.find("float"));
}
